Transaction 68cd396fbcd21708dff569465f307f86ae00918c42939fac65751709be3af172
1 Input
1 Output
-
68cd396fbcd21708dff569465f307f86ae00918c42939fac65751709be3af172:0
- value
- 849075
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e4fbbffeec9780ed191b343972f0d74f3efa260
- address
- bc1q8e8mhllwe9uqa5v3kdpewtcdwne7lgnqy6vg7f